Output 594d3dba365921ed52bf724177520165ffcc44bb0e5e6f8ad3f61264f21733c7:0

value
1823867743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8c8a79e6f87047938eebc499c0f60e7e880d2ef OP_EQUAL
address
3Nus4nX9XaXqVrgcehvGcLgcFRE8PQoY7z
transaction
594d3dba365921ed52bf724177520165ffcc44bb0e5e6f8ad3f61264f21733c7
spent
true